Apple Arcade in May 2026 with a big dose of family entertainment Nick Jr. Replay!, new games

Apple Arcade is preparing a big month for gamers, especially younger ones and those playing with family. From May 7, several new titles will be added to the library, led by Nick Jr. Replay!, which brings together well-known characters from popular cartoons in one interactive game. This is a clear signal that Apple wants to place even more emphasis on family and educational games.

Nick Jr. Replay! introduces iconic characters in one game

The new production allows children to meet heroes known from series such as Dora, Paw Patrol, and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les. The game offers over 50 mini-games and activities that not only entertain but also develop skills – from math to problem-solving. Importantly, everything takes place in a safe environment, without ads and microtransactions, which is one of the biggest advantages of Apple Arcade.

New games expand the offering with simulations and puzzle games

In addition to Nick Jr. Replay!, Apple is also adding other titles: Good Pizza, Great Pizza+ (a pizzeria management simulator), Perchang World (a physics-based puzzle game), and Ultimate 8 Ball Pool+. This means the offering is not limited to children – there will also be something for older gamers looking for more classic gameplay.

May will also bring plenty of new content to the already available games. Hello Kitty Island Adventure will receive a narrative finale, and Disney SpellStruck will expand its content with elements from the Star Wars: Return of the Jedi universe. Additionally, there will be Barbie-related events focused on fashion and creativity, further highlighting the family-friendly nature of the platform.

The service costs 34.99 PLN per month and allows up to six people to play under a single subscription. The absence of ads and in-app purchases remains one of the biggest advantages that set Apple Arcade apart from many other mobile platforms.

May on Apple Arcade is shaping up to be very solid. New games and updates clearly show that the platform is targeting family gaming and safe entertainment without microtransactions.
